首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

新手,怎么返回这样的查询结果集

2012-01-06 
新手求助,如何返回这样的查询结果集各位大虾帮忙啊现有如下表结构:产品表:idname规格price1注射用头孢曲松

新手求助,如何返回这样的查询结果集
各位大虾帮忙啊
现有如下表结构:

产品表:
idname                               规格price
1注射用头孢曲松钠1.0G*10支*100盒1.9
6注射用头孢曲松钠1.0G*10支*45盒1.8

销售明细表:
id   部门   子部门   用户名   日期   二级商   协议额   产品   数量   价格   金额
1   销售三部   贵阳办张三*2006-9   **公司   30     1       10000   1.9   19000
2   销售三部   贵阳办张三*2000-9   **公司   30     6   10000   1.8   18000
3   销售一部   成都办李四   *2006-8   **公司   30   610000   1.8   18000

想生成的结果:
                                                                                [                       产品1             ]     [
部门   办事处   分销代表   二级商协议额   月份   数量(支)价格(元)   金额(元)   数量(支)
销售三部   贵阳办   张三   **公司   30     *2006-9     10000     1.9           19000           10000
销售一部   成都办   李四   **公司   30     *2006-9     0               0               0             10000

              产品2       ]     [产品n]
价格(元)   金额(元)   .....     合计
1.818000             37000
1.818000               0

说明以上   数量   价格   金额   每三个为一组,没有相应的数据就留空或为0,合计为所有产品金额的总和




[解决办法]
這樣的格式, 最好放到前台程序做

热点排行